(en.wikipedia.org)Additionally, the Uganda Women’s Network (UWONET) is an umbrella organization of national women’s NGOs and individuals operating in East Africa. UWONET works to advance public policy regarding women’s rights and has been instrumental in advocating for gender equality in Uganda.
